Output 6c0aeb3c3ad7aca1f0850c5ee3991fd1ce7a27ec43aeafc24d7266814a0c583c:0

value
10223207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fab3405df63598501e281fd68ffc117307836b7 OP_EQUAL
address
3N5fhjHQ3CHw5K664VBBtUEgCY5esa5ESk
transaction
6c0aeb3c3ad7aca1f0850c5ee3991fd1ce7a27ec43aeafc24d7266814a0c583c
spent
true